So I just noticed this gizmo.
On betfair when you are placing an each way bet you can adjust the terms if you want.
For example I can bet on Top Tug in Catterick 14:20 today odds 3.25. Standard place terms are 1/5 odds, 3 places.
This is almost value as you’re getting odds 3.25/1.45 for the win/place(3) on the bookie and the lays are at 3.7/1.27 on the exchange.
BUT
If I toggle the Each Way Edge widget to only pay two places then this will increase the odds to 4.33! Giving 4.33/1.67 for the win/place(2), where the lays are 3.7/1.59 (2 to place). Which is better value.
Maybe its something someone wants to look into, but at least at first glance on this example looks like you can stretch the value you get e/w arbing by using the edge.
Anyone use this feature regularly?

+0Taking Tasleet as an example in the 16.20:-
Select E/W and reduce the place terms from 4 to 2.
This will increase the odds from 8.5 to 16.0
50p e/w (total bet £1) will return £10 if the horse wins – the effective decimal odds on the win are 10.0.
You can lay the win at 9.2 atm, if you plug your total stake (ie £1 if you bet 50p ew) into Matt’s calculator and the effective odds of 10.0 and the lay odds of 9.2 it will tell you the optimum lay to guarantee a small profit.
Worst case scenario is you make a small profit but, if the horse finishes second you will win your lay and the place part of your ew edge bet = £££££££!
